Whitecap Resources (TSE:WCP) and PrairieSky Royalty (TSE:PSK) are both mid-cap energy companies, but which is the better stock? We will compare the two businesses based on the strength of their media sentiment, valuation, profitability, dividends, analyst recommendations, risk, earnings, community ranking and institutional ownership.
Whitecap Resources has a beta of 2.81, meaning that its share price is 181% more volatile than the S&P 500. Comparatively, PrairieSky Royalty has a beta of 1.81, meaning that its share price is 81% more volatile than the S&P 500.
In the previous week, Whitecap Resources had 2 more articles in the media than PrairieSky Royalty. MarketBeat recorded 18 mentions for Whitecap Resources and 16 mentions for PrairieSky Royalty. PrairieSky Royalty's average media sentiment score of 0.69 beat Whitecap Resources' score of 0.48 indicating that PrairieSky Royalty is being referred to more favorably in the news media.
PrairieSky Royalty has a net margin of 47.46% compared to Whitecap Resources' net margin of 27.52%. Whitecap Resources' return on equity of 16.89% beat PrairieSky Royalty's return on equity.
Whitecap Resources currently has a consensus target price of C$13.56, suggesting a potential upside of 28.07%. PrairieSky Royalty has a consensus target price of C$27.30, suggesting a potential upside of 0.74%. Given Whitecap Resources' stronger consensus rating and higher possible upside, analysts plainly believe Whitecap Resources is more favorable than PrairieSky Royalty.
22.2% of Whitecap Resources shares are owned by institutional investors. Comparatively, 63.2% of PrairieSky Royalty shares are owned by institutional investors. 0.7% of Whitecap Resources shares are owned by company insiders. Comparatively, 0.5% of PrairieSky Royalty shares are owned by company insiders. Strong institutional ownership is an indication that large money managers, endowments and hedge funds believe a stock is poised for long-term growth.
Whitecap Resources received 518 more outperform votes than PrairieSky Royalty when rated by MarketBeat users. Likewise, 78.85% of users gave Whitecap Resources an outperform vote while only 61.85% of users gave PrairieSky Royalty an outperform vote.
Whitecap Resources pays an annual dividend of C$0.65 per share and has a dividend yield of 6.1%. PrairieSky Royalty pays an annual dividend of C$1.00 per share and has a dividend yield of 3.7%. Whitecap Resources pays out 44.5% of its earnings in the form of a dividend. PrairieSky Royalty pays out 105.3% of its earnings in the form of a dividend, suggesting it may not have sufficient earnings to cover its dividend payment in the future. Whitecap Resources is clearly the better dividend stock, given its higher yield and lower payout ratio.
Whitecap Resources has higher revenue and earnings than PrairieSky Royalty. Whitecap Resources is trading at a lower price-to-earnings ratio than PrairieSky Royalty, indicating that it is currently the more affordable of the two stocks.
